Songster Sami Turns Actor; Tabu, Rani, Vidya Probable Leads!
By MovieTalkies.com, 08 November 2010

Having won a long pending case against his former wife for possession of his home, songster Adnan Sami, slimmer and fitter, is gearing up for the new avatar of his life. That of an actor, that is, cast in a quirky comedy about a Punjabi man's search for Ms. Right who will love and look after his dear mother too. The movie will mark the directorial debut of Bela Sehgal, sibling of Sanjay Leela Bhansali, who's edited all of SLB's movies and has been biding her time to turn director for close to four years.
Reportedly, Bela had approached Adnan earlier with a script centred around a grossly obese man. As Adnan shed off pounds and turned a tad svelte, Bela was faced with the option of casting another actor (Vinay Pathak was considered, as per sources) or scrap the venture altogether. Apparently, she settled for the latter, and came up with a spanking new script for the vocalist whom she'd directed in her music videos earlier.
States Adnan cautiously in a media chat, "It's finally happening, and I am all set for my acting debut. I can speak officially about it in a month's time from now. Bela Sehgal and I go a long way and she's a dear friend too."
The Sami comedy will be produced by SLB and an announcement to that effect will be made after 'Guzaarish' releases. As per sources, Rani Mukerji, Tabu and Vidya Balan have been shortlisted among the probable leads for Adnan.
